Like any other product or service, healthcare also conducts marketing to consumers. Specifically, healthcare marketing is the process of designing strategic communication to attract healthcare products and services consumers, guide them on their healthcare journey, and keep them engaged in healthcare products or services.
According to a Pew Research report, about 66% of internet users have relied on the internet to search for information about a specific disease or medical problem. Moreover, about 44% of internet users have searched for information regarding doctors and other health professionals. Artificial Intelligence (AI) is a tool that can help healthcare marketing, especially in using data analytics for better patient outcomes. Based on a Statista report, the AI in healthcare market size worldwide was valued at 11.06 billion USD, which includes AI’s value in healthcare marketing.
So with AI’s vast potential to provide efficient and convenient healthcare assistance, let’s take a deeper look at how AI influences healthcare marketing.
Automating Marketing Tasks
Most healthcare providers, such as hospitals and clinics, mainly allot their resources to provide the best patient services, leaving the marketing aspect with little to no attention. But through AI, you can automate healthcare marketing efforts.
For instance, healthcare providers maximize social media platforms to reach patients and other consumers based on demographics. With an AI-driven management tool, they can automate content generation, upload content in advance, and post at times that will likely gain more engagement.
Furthermore, AI tools designed for social media can automatically analyze based on customer/client interaction and provide recommendations that capture up-to-date information and user behavior.
Supporting Personalization
About 71% of consumers expect personalization from the brands and businesses they patronize. This statistic can also be true and applicable to healthcare marketing, especially since healthcare is mostly a personalized experience for patients and consumers.
As healthcare consumers expect personalized experiences, AI can be a powerful tool that healthcare marketing agencies can use for personalization. Together with software tools that can analyze data gained from consumers, AI can effectively provide and customize content, advice, and service recommendations tailored for each patient or consumer. AI-driven chatbots can also help provide information and assistance.
Moreover, the personalization of consumers’ experiences may improve health literacy. That way, healthcare consumers can be more aware of the signs of diseases and learn how to take care of their bodies and health.
Predicting Future Trends and Patterns
As its name implies, predictive analytics predicts future outcomes and performance using statistics and modeling techniques based on historical data. Usually, it is incorporated with AI and machine learning to derive significant improvements, such as reduced cost, efficient analysis, increased profitability, better security, and reduced environmental impact.
Like business processes, healthcare marketing can gain improvements with predictive analytics powered by AI. For instance, it can foresee the most profitable marketing channels and identify the most promising prospects to target them with personalized messages and content.
Moreover, it helps manage patient retention by analyzing the patient’s satisfaction scores, behaviors, and engagement history. The AI can identify patterns and signals that can indicate the decision of patients to leave or retain a healthcare product or service. AI can help healthcare providers understand their consumers and identify the areas they need to improve.
